6.  LONG-TERM DEBT

 

Credit Facility

 

At September 30, 2013, we had $662.8 million of availability under our $1.25 billion revolving credit facility dated September 26, 2011 (the “Credit Facility”) with SunTrust Bank but, except for borrowings that are used to refinance other debt, we are limited to $517.6 million of additional borrowing capacity by the financial covenants under our Credit Facility.

 

In August 2013, we extended the maturity date of our Credit Facility by one year to September 26, 2017, which we may further extend for up to one additional year.

 

Extinguishment of Debt

 

In July 2013, we repaid in full the $300.0 million principal amount outstanding under the 4.625% Notes due on July 15, 2013 (the “4.625% Notes”) and approximately $6.9 million of related accrued interest using funds available under our Credit Facility.

 

Notes Offering

 

In June 2013, we issued $500.0 million of 4.150% Notes due July 1, 2023 (the “4.150% Notes”) in an underwritten public offering at 99.81% of their principal amount.  Total proceeds from this offering, after underwriting fees, expenses and debt issuance costs of $3.3 million, were approximately $495.8 million.  We used the net proceeds from this offering for general partnership purposes and to repay amounts due under our Credit Facility, a portion of which was subsequently reborrowed in July 2013 in order to repay in full the 4.625% Notes and related accrued interest (as discussed above).
